established throughout the Rift Valley to the eastern border with the Ngorongoro Conservation spot, Natron is Probably the most starkly wonderful of all the Rift Valley lakes south of Turkana. Pretty much 60km extended but nowhere in excess of a metre deep, this primordial alkaline sump is renowned for its caustic and unusually viscous waters, that are enclosed by a crust of volcanic ash and salt, as well as a handful of isolated swamp patches fed by bubbling sizzling springs. There exists some huge wildlife in the region, but Natron’s key faunal claim to fame is as the sole recognized breeding ground for East Africa’s 2.5 million lesser flamingos, which congregate at an inaccessible Component of the lake between August and October. Natron also attracts as many as a hundred,000 migrant waders throughout the European Wintertime. the leading attraction near the Natron is Ol Doinyo Lengai, the Maasai ‘Mountain of God’, a textbook volcano that rises over 2km earlier mentioned the bordering Rift Valley floor to an altitude of 2,960m.

The crater has a single endemic species of mammal: Mduma's shrew (Crocidura mdumai), which is limited to montane forests on the edge of your crater. This shrew is considered endangered on account of deforestation from smallholder farming.[32][33]
